Output 34d4820e6e0e5fd51ac0ba7cd2d2801c581d9d00319dd441fbe8dad71252a8a6:1

value
15593962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78afcf2ddd7807014b30ec3bb08224af8b8fab05 OP_EQUAL
address
3Ch9d1Niy7CtCXkivDymmpFZhCc4tZzSE9
transaction
34d4820e6e0e5fd51ac0ba7cd2d2801c581d9d00319dd441fbe8dad71252a8a6
spent
true